On Tuesday October 14, the Université Côte d'Azur's Mission Handicap welcomed the Club des employeurs conventionnés du Fonds pour l'insertion des personnes handicapées dans la Fonction publique (FIPHFP) to the Grand Château on the Valrose campus for a day on the theme of "Recruitment".
Organized by Handi-Pacte PACA-Corse and Université Côte d'Azur, the day brought together a number of representatives of public-sector employers with FIPHFP agreements in Provence Alpes Côte d'Azur(human resources managers, directors, disability correspondents, disability mission managers, etc.).
A day of co-construction and exchange around the recruitment of disabled people
The day began with introductory remarks by Thierry Allemand, representative of the Fonds pour l'Insertion des Personnes Handicapées dans la Fonction Publique (FIPHFP), and Pierre Crescenzo, Vice-President of Disability Policy at Université Côte d'Azur. The morning continued with a round-table discussion entitled "Gateways to employment", bringing togetherESRP Le Coteau, ESAT Open Provence and CFA Métropole Nice Côte d'Azur. The first part of the day ended with a convivial cocktail lunch.
The afternoon was devoted to collaborative workshops around three key themes:
Attractiveness,
Sourcing,
Raising awareness of disability issues among juries and recruiters.
